Background

Alcoholic Liver Disease (ALD) refers to liver damage caused by long-term excess of alcohol, initially manifested as significant adipocyte steatosis, which may later progress to steatohepatitis, hepatic fibrosis and cirrhosis. According to the difference of liver damage degree of patients, the liver damage treatment method is divided into the following types: mild alcoholic liver disease: slight abnormalities in one or more of liver biochemical markers, imaging and histological findings; alcoholic fatty liver: fatty liver can be seen in the imaging examination, and the biochemical indexes of the liver can be slightly abnormal; alcoholic hepatitis: mainly shows that the level of serum transaminase and glutamyl transpeptidase is increased, which is usually accompanied by the increase of serum bilirubin and fever and peripheral blood neutrophilic granulocytosis; alcoholic liver fibrosis: symptoms and signs of a patient and common laboratory and ultrasonic examination and the like are not changed characteristically, the serum hepatic fibrosis index and liver instantaneous imaging examination elasticity value can be increased, and further diagnosis is confirmed through liver biopsy; alcoholic cirrhosis: the liver cirrhosis has symptoms and signs of liver cirrhosis, the elasticity value of liver instantaneous imaging examination is obviously increased, and the imaging changes of ultrasound, CT and the like accord with the liver cirrhosis. Alcoholic liver disease belongs to the category of 'wine injury', 'wine addiction', 'wine drum' and 'alcoholic jaundice' in traditional Chinese medicine. The cause of the disease is the pathogenic factors of alcohol-toxin dampness-heat. The disease is first in the liver, gallbladder, spleen and stomach, and then in the kidney. The pathogenesis of the disease is that damp-heat and alcohol-toxin damage a human body, which causes liver depression and qi stagnation, water-dampness failure, phlegm turbidity generation, liver and spleen blood stasis and viscera deficiency.

The decoction for removing blood stasis comes from Furen recorded in Zhang Zhongjing jin Jian Yao L ü e. The original prescription is rhubarb, radix et rhizoma Rhei, radix Et rhizoma Rhei, semen Persicae, 20 Eupolyphaga seu steleophaga, feet are decocted, the three flavors are added, the powder is added, honey is refined, and the mixture is made into four pills, one liter of wine is used for decocting one pill, and the eight pills are taken. It can be used for treating abdominal pain due to stagnation of blood. Modern medicine popularizes and uses the decoction for removing blood stasis, for example, hepatitis with blood stasis symptom, liver cirrhosis, cerebral concussion sequelae, apoplexy sequelae, etc. However, the application of the blood stasis removing decoction to the treatment of chronic alcoholic steatohepatitis is not reported. Although there are reports in the literature that rhubarb, peach kernel and/or Chinese polyphaga in the decoction for removing blood stasis are used for treating alcoholic liver disease, only 1-2 of the Chinese medicines are contained and are often combined with other traditional Chinese medicines, such as Jiaxiuqin (Jiawei Wendan decoction for treating alcoholic fatty liver 38 cases [ J xiuqin]Chinese and Western medicine combined liver disease journal, 1996,6(2):34) and modified Wendan decoction (20 g each of fructus Aurantii Immaturus, purified pinellia Tuber, Coptidis rhizoma, 15g each of Poria, etc., 12g each of pericarpium Citri Tangerinae, caulis Bambusae in Taenia, semen Persicae, bupleuri radix, radix Paeoniae Rubra, radix Paeoniae alba, 30g each of Saviae Miltiorrhizae radix and fructus crataegi, 24g of carapax Trionycis) for treating alcoholic fatty liver; zhoubao et al (Zhoubao, Liujian, Fangjiang Yong, etc.. Jiekang granule for treating chronic alcoholic liver disease 30 cases [ J]Journal of liver disease combining traditional Chinese and western medicine 2002,12(3): 181-. In addition, an article published earlier in this subject group (Cheng Liu, Xia Yuan, Le Tao. Xia-yu-xue-xuedeCotion (XYXD)) reduce carbon tetrachloride (CCl)4) -induced blood stasis activating by targeting NF-. kappa.B and dTGF- β 1signaling pathways BMC Complementary and Alternative Medicine 2015,15:201) discloses that ecchymoma-discharging decoction is effective in treating CCl4Induced liver fibrosis. An article published in the early stage of this subject group (Wuliu, Zhang Jie, mahencing, et al. decoction for removing blood stasis in mice for inhibition of non-alcoholic steatohepatitis induced by choline methionine deficiency [ J]Chinese journal of liver diseases (electronic edition), 2018,10(03):54-61) reported that the decoction for removing blood stasis has a significant improvement effect on MCD-induced nonalc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H) in mice. In this article, the MCD-induced NASH model is an 8-week mouse, which is accompanied by liver fibrosis, and it is difficult to determine whether the effect of the decoction for removing blood stasis on the improvement of the mouse model is based on the treatment of liver fibrosisThe application is as follows. Furthermore, the causes and mechanisms of chronic alcoholic steatohepatitis and non-alcoholic steatohepatitis are greatly different, so that it is difficult to predict the effect of the stagnant blood-draining decoction on chronic alcoholic steatohepatitis.

the decoction for removing blood stasis consists of rhubarb, peach kernel and ground beetle, has the efficacies of removing blood stasis, invigorating blood circulation, purging and stimulating the menstrual flow, and is used for treating postpartum abdominal pain caused by blood stasis and blood stasis stagnation of women. In the recipe, rhubarb, bitter in flavor and cold in flavor, is mainly used for removing blood stasis, breaking abdominal mass and accumulating, and has new effect of aging; peach kernel, semen Persicae is bitter and neutral in taste, is mainly used for treating blood stasis and blood stasis, and has the effects of promoting blood circulation, removing blood stasis and moistening dryness; the ground beetle is good at breaking stasis and eliminating abdominal mass, attacking blood stasis and opening blood stasis, and has the combined effects of promoting blood circulation and removing blood stasis, and softening hardness and dissipating stagnation.
